# Changelog
|
||||
|
||||
## main
|
||||
- breaking: CCListLabel.compare and CCListLabel.equal takes the function on the elements as named arguments
|
||||
- breaking: CCListLabel.init now takes the length as a named arguments to follow the Stdlib
|
||||
- breaking: invert the argument of CCFun.compose to align it with the Stdlib
|
||||
- breaking: change the semantic of CCFloat.{min,max} with respect to NaN to follow the Stdlib
|
||||
- breaking: change the semantic of CCInt.rem with respect to negative number to follow the Stdlib
|
||||
- breaking: change the order of argument of CCMap.add_seq to align with the stdlib.
|
||||
|
||||
## 3.17
|
||||
|
||||
- feat: add `CCAtomic.update_cas`
|
||||
- feat: add `Pvec.flat_map`
|
||||
- faster `List.take_drop` thanks to a trick by nojb
|
||||
|
||||
- move to ocamlformat 0.27, format code
|
||||
- test: enrich pvec test
|
||||
- Patch CBor roundtrip property to hold for nan's too (thanks @jmid)
|
||||
|
||||
## 3.16
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
- breaking: Renamed predicate parameter of `take_while`, `rtake_while` from `p` to `f`, aligining it with pre-existing `drop_while`.
|
||||
|
||||
- feat: add `containers.leb128` library
|
||||
- feat: add `CCFun.with_return`
|
||||
- Added functions to the `Char` module to check common character properties.
|
||||
- feat: add `CCVector.findi`
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
- fix: compat with OCaml 5.4
|
||||
- fix: oob(!!) in CCHash.bytes
